Ottakee Posted January 4, 2018 Share Posted January 4, 2018 Hopefully they will decide what is best for the baby. It could well be that the other family is not able to take on a special needs child. If you are able to adopt the baby, please try to get contact information for the adoptive family of the 1/2 sibling and make/keep contact as appropriate. My son has 7 siblings that he now has contact with but for many years, there was no contact with some of them and he missed out on that.My girls have 6 other siblings, 4 we found now as young adults, 1 deceased as a young adult, and 1 that we still haven't located. Finding their siblings has been a huge deal for them. I wish we could have done this more/sooner, etc. but it took us almost 20 years of searching to locate them.Even with 1/2 siblings there is a biological bond there and while in the cases of all 3 of my kids it was in their (and their siblings) best interest to not all be adopted together, it is a very positive thing that they have contact now. 3 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
